Immediate Actions After Water Damage
1. **Turn Off Water Supply**: Locate the main water valve and turn it off to prevent further flooding.
2. **Remove Excess Water**: Use pumps, mops, or towels to remove as much water as possible.
3. **Contact Professionals**: Call a reputable Water Damage Cleanup company to assess the damage and begin restoration efforts.
4. **Disconnect Electrical Appliances**: Turn off and unplug any electrical appliances or devices that have come into contact with water.
5. **Document the Damage**: Take photos and videos of the damage for insurance purposes.
Can Water Damage Be Fixed in a House?
Yes, water damage can be fixed in a house. The extent of the repairs will depend on the severity of the damage. Minor water damage, such as a leaky roof, can often be repaired quickly and easily. More extensive damage, such as a flooded basement, may require extensive repairs and restoration work.
Steps Involved in Water Damage Repair:
* **Assessment and Extraction:** The first step is to assess the extent of the damage and extract any standing water.
* **Drying and Dehumidification:** Professional equipment is used to dry out the affected areas and prevent mold growth.
* **Cleaning and Disinfection:** The affected areas are thoroughly cleaned and disinfected to remove any residual contaminants.
* **Restoration:** Once the area is dry and clean, repairs can be made to walls, ceilings, and other structural components.
